After a small appearance in the Eighties, male skirt is coming back in the processions of haute couture and prêt a porter in Europe, as well in the world of spectacle. In the street however, it is done more discreetly. And this, because! It is still regarded as the emblem of women! And if men agree to low their trousers down, they refuse to lose their virility.

 

 

1985. The stylist Jean-Paul Gaultier releases a real bomb in the fashion world by creating wardrobe for two, a collection of clothing including the skirt for man. Unthinkable. Inconceivable. At this time, nobody followed the terrible child of the French mode. However, the idea made s its way gently and today, nearly twenty years later, the designers of the whole world are agree for masculinize this expensive clothing with the women. No flowered rustles, laces or reasons, but of the traditional and purified lines, sober colours and pockets with flies for the functional side… A few stylists present even the skirt for man like impossible to avoid into their collection. On jupe.i-hej.com, French website devoted to the male skirt, we learn that the eccentric Vivienne Westwood integrated clothing in its Autumn collection/winter 2006-2007, which it is also presented in the collections the mar of Montesino, Mi mar and Puerto Rico of Francis Montesinos, and that Agnès B. envisages to include in her collection men be 2007.

 

Attempt to virility


In the world of the spectacle, in particular that of the musicals; male skirts are also very appreciated. Kamel Ouali, the most known choreographer in the hexagon, does not hesitate for example to make star academicians’ boys dance wearing skirt or long tunic on prime-time shows. As far as the musician Florian Dubos, Kyo group, is concerned, he appears dressed in a long black skirt in the clip” the last dance”. Even the football player David Beckham appears into public in sarong, this long narrow loincloth. But everybody is not david Beckham wants and what is considered as elegant on a sex-symbol can become quite simply ridiculous on an anonymous. The skirt is the prerogative of women and transvestites it is still source of heavy prejudices, which explains why it is so difficult to see skirt into the streets. “The skirt for man is often associated to homosexuality, explains Jerome Salome, the creator of the jupe.i-hej.com site. That is why very few men dare to face the glance of people while wearing this type of clothing. The weight of Society is so important that even the one who wears skirt wonders about his motivations. Before being able to go out in the street, I wondered a long time whether this clothing taste did not hide a driven back homosexuality or a desire to disguise myself as a woman. But discussing with others heterosexuals fond of skirts on forums on Internet sites, I realized that I was not alone to like skirts and that did not question my sexuality». Since about four years, Jerome has worn the skirt proudly, even if he has still to face the laugh and the gibes in the street. “However, reflexions cease themselves, when I walk myself with my wife and my two children, he notices. That is the proof that only homosexuality is targeted. As soon as people become aware of my sexual membership, they are calmed and reassured.” Since a few years, Jerome works hard to democratise the wearing of male skirt, especially talking about his experience in the regional and national press, and by leading various actions through the hexagon. A long and hard job, because this clothe is not particularly accessible. Because although there are some good addresses in Paris and that it is possible to buy on line, the price remains relatively high. “The less expensive skirt is around hundred euros and the average price is around 200 to 300 euros, says this father. As far as I am concerned, I determined myself to look for skirts into women clothing store and buy mixed skirts with more attractive prices.”

 

Reunion Island is septic

 
Will it be enough to low the prices of men’s skirt to make them adopt it? If in the hexagon, the professionals of fashion believe in the future of the product, the reunion Island is rather sceptical  “Réunionnais have already difficulties to leave traditional, that will be very difficult to make them wear a skirt, ensure Julie Danielle, designer at Danielle fashion creation.  Men are too machos in reunion Island. Only few marginal will try.” “Perhaps young people will let themselves convince by the skirt, but then it would be necessary that it is very male,” The manager of Technic-couture,an organism which trains girls to the seam, insists for his  part , I would prefer  a divided skirt which would be like  trousers, a bit like a skirt for  samurai for example.” At caramel Bleu, we initially prefer to observe the evolution of the phenomenon before deciding… “Fifteen years ago, we have creates our line of skirts for man, but that did not give anything of conclusive, explains Sylvie, stylist. We tried to hold two years, in vain. However, I do not desperate to see one-day skirts for men in the street. Who knows, perhaps that with time mentalities will change…”

- The woman and trousers. If nowadays women can wear trousers when they want, it hasn’t been always like that, several decades were necessary before the Society accepts the wearing of trousers by females. Pioneer on the matter, the writer George Sand already went for a walk in trousers in the years 1840, but it was necessary to wait the 1900’s to see other women following her example. Only the rebel women risk themselves there, because they were always taken for homosexual. The First World War made it possible for women workers to wear this cloth. Gradually, women affirmed themselves on the professional plan, social and clothing and after the Second World War; workmen’s jean became fashionable but only as clothing of leisure. In cities, it remains improper. The trousers is feminised only in the Sixties and in 1965, we creates more trousers than skirts. The following year, stylists created the trouser suit for women. Since the Seventies trousers are mixed.
